Kiki Opuru torn between culture and sexuality in acting: Says, “My body is precious”

Kiki Opuru torn between culture and sexuality in acting: Says, “My body is precious”

BY DAMILOLA SHOLOLA

Kiki Opuru is a fast-rising actress in Nollywood and she has appeared in over 20 movies including The Baby, Island Babes, Daddy’s Girl, and Yankee Student, to name a few. Even though she has captivating sex appeals, the cute and vivacious actress prefers to tow the line of caution when interpreting scripts in order not to come into conflict with her Nigerian culture. In this exclusive interview, she talks about her career, life, and more:

How do you get into character when you see a script?

Kiki-Opuru-1After reading the script, you picture the character you’re acting and you put yourself into that character. Let’s say I’m acting as a prostitute, I should have that imagination of a prostitute; how they behave, how they think, how they dress, then you fit yourself into that character and you’re good to go.

Can you play a very daring or challenging role in a movie?

Yes, I would love to do that. I have done it once in Island Babes; that was the first time. They gave me a role to act like an Indian goddess. It was so challenging because I had never done something like that before. They just called me immediately and asked me to do it.

I checked the script and it was full of incantations, invocations and all that. I was so taken aback at first I thought I would not be able to do it but I gave it my best shot. I thank God it came out well

What is the first thing you look out for in a script?

The first thing I look out for is the storyline because the storyline matters a lot.

Have you ever been faced with challenges like sexual harassment and all that?

To me, I would say no because I have my manager who does everything for me. He would just call me and say “Kiki, come and pick your script, I know you can do this”. If I’m qualified for the role then I do it and if I’m not qualified, another person takes over.

Which movie did you enjoy working on the set most?

Mixed Feelings. It is a movie I want everybody to watch. The twist in the movie is killing. I won’t say I did my best but at least I am impressed with what I did.

If they give you a story that has a sexual scene in it, would you do it?

As an artist, I would do it because it’s my job but it depends on the story. This is Nollywood so there should be a limit because of our culture.

Can you wear a bikini in a movie?

No I can’t do that. My body is precious.

Can you kiss in a movie?

I did something like that with the late Muna Obiekwe in a movie called Agonized but it’s not yet out. He was my boyfriend in the movie.

Have you ever been attracted, or had a crush on any actor you’ve worked with?

No, I haven’t.

How did you get into acting?

I went to an acting school called Manex Movie Academy. It was from there I got into it. I have this passion for acting; I like to see myself on TV, people telling me we saw you on TV and all that. So that was how I started.
